2. Swimming with dwarf Minke whales in the great coral reef

This is the one thing that everyone should try at least once in their lifetime. The great coral reef in Australia offers lots of amazing things, but one of the best is swimming with dwarf Minke whales. These whales are known to have a fascination with humans, and even bring their calves along when swimming with humans. The whole experience is simply breathtaking.

3. Play with sea lions

This is another interesting marine life sightings in Australia. Sea lions are some of the most playful marine life animals. They love to swim up to people then do acrobatic shows. That’s why they have been nicknamed sea puppies. The opportunity to swim with these lovely creatures is one that a tourist visiting Australia should not pass up on.

One of the best places to watch them is the Eyre Peninsula in Southern Australia. It’s an amazing place to relax as you take photos and videos swimming alongside these beautiful animals.
